Transaction 5617085d0fc4c1faa44c2b77002f4ea32521241980ab54ec2b3680098297e0dd
1 Input
1 Output
-
5617085d0fc4c1faa44c2b77002f4ea32521241980ab54ec2b3680098297e0dd:0
- value
- 1035246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9f873e8652cdf684e9054c4630b1c0a7d94d336 OP_EQUAL
- address
- 3MZYByK2P26pCXSeBQunfBxN1of44SM1Cp